Explore Morocco in the context of a rapidly changing cultural and communications
environment. Immerse yourself in the Fez medina, largest pedestrian city space in the
world. Join a cultural festival and live in homestays in the old Medina where Africa, the
Arab world and Europe have met for centuries and are meeting. Discover this city that is
undergoing rapid transformations with changes in global transport and digitalization.
